Just a little question as I tested a lot already. This is about the extreme lag that I get on the Australia Servers.
Very often I just disconnect with Error 4001 ‘Protocol error’. I get over 6000ms delay notification on the screen and then I can just wait for the game to disconnect.
Here some information:
My PC is an Intel I7 8x3800MHz, 16GB RAM, 512GB SSD. NVidia GTX 670 (2GB model).
All is on Gigabit CAT6 wired network in my house and I have a fast Fibreglass Internet connection.
Still I get, on for instance Vena V, that chunks just take a really long time to load. Chunks on that picture below took about 8 to 10 sec to load.
As you can see in the debug screen it is “waiting for chunks”. The rest looks fine (rendering, FPS etc)
I was monitoring the network activity and it only gets peaks of about 2.7MB/sec from time to time. And with my connection that should be just a little bit of bandwidth.
To let you know my connection speed:
So It is not my PC that is slow, or my Internet that is slow. I am just not receiving data. (or data in time.)
I looked up the IP address of the Vena V Server and started a Trace Route to 54.206.109.110.
Here is the output:
Tracing route to ec2-54-206-109-110.ap-southeast-2.compute.amazonaws.com [54.206.109.110] over a maximum of 30 hops:

My conclusion is that I am not receiving the data in time, or just not at all.
But I cannot do anything about this.
So my question to the DEVS:
Is there anything I can still try to do or do I have to accept that playing on the Australia Servers is just no longer an option for me ? (and that sucks as Diamonds/Emeralds are only on Australia Servers)
